In 1937, Elizabeth A. Lee entered the world in Jennings St, Missouri, born to Christopher Lebeau And Alice Le Beau. In 1940, Elizabeth A. Lee resided in St Ferdinand Township, St Ferdinand, St Louis, Mis. In 1952, Elizabeth A. Lee resided in Missouri. Elizabeth A. Lee married Russell Lee, and had children including Lebeau, Patricia Ann Lee, Russell C Lee, Sandra Norine Lee. Elizabeth A. Lee passed away in 1999 in Lemay, St. Louis County, Missouri, United States of America.
